The 2026 RBC Canadian Open continues on Saturday with the third round at TPC Toronto. You can find full RBC Canadian Open tee times for Saturday’s third round at the bottom of this post.

RBC Canadian Open tee times: What to know

After firing a second-round 63, American Ben James leads the charge at the Canadian Open’s halfway point with a 36-hole score of 10 under par.

The 23-year-old just completed his senior season at the University of Virginia and is riding some incredible momentum. The RBC Canadian Open marks James’ pro debut after earning his Tour card by finishing first in the PGA Tour University Ranking, and he’s leading the tournament by one shot after also qualifying for his third U.S. Open on Monday this week.

“I wasn’t really thinking about really results at all this week,” James said after his round. “Just worried about getting comfortable, making new friends and having fun, and just seeing where everything kind of falls. Just seeing where my game stacks up. Obviously I have some stuff to work on, just trying to see where everything goes. Because this is just the baseline, it’s my first professional debut. Obviously had a great two days, but just trying to get better.”

It won’t be an easy task to earn a W in his first-ever event as a pro — especially considering the number of players within close proximity. There are 17 players within three shots of his lead, including Sam Burns (-9), Brooks Koepka (-8) and Sahith Theegala (-7).

James will tee off in the third round at 1:45 p.m. ET alongside Sam Burns.

On Thursday, World No. 1 Nelly Korda found trouble off the tee — even had to change her shoes mid-round — and went straight to the range following her opening-round 73 at the U.S. Women’s Open. As for Friday? She might have figured it out. Korda’s four-under 67 was the lowest round of the day, and it put her right back into the mix at Riviera Country Club in Pacific Palisades, Calif. Here’s what you need to know for Saturday.

U.S. Women’s Open Saturday tee times: What to know

While Korda’s 67 was the best round of the day, several players, including Alison Lee, shot 68. Lee made just one bogey and shares the 36-hole lead with Ruoning Yin. Tied at four under, that duo will tee off in the final pairing at 5:45 p.m. ET on Saturday.

“I feel like I did a really good job at just grinding out there, saving a lot of pars,” Lee said. “I mean, even today on hole 2, I pushed my drive right and had to punch out. I was able to make like a 6-footer for par from like 100 yards in. It’s shots like that, holes like that that I feel like really make you or break you for this week.”

American Jennifer Kupcho is three under and one off the lead, and Korda is among a group of contenders at two under.

Michelle Wie West, playing in her final U.S. Women’s Open via her 10-year exemption from her 2014 Pinehurst No. 2 win, shot 75-74 to miss the cut.

The 2026 Charles Schwab Challenge continues on Saturday with the third round at Colonial Country Club in Texas. You can find full Charles Schwab Challenge tee times for Saturday’s third round at the bottom of this post.

It’s a crowded leaderboard at the halfway point in Texas, where Jordan Smith leads the charge at 10 under par through 36 holes, but 23 other players are within four shots of him, including major winners Brian Harman and Hideki Matsuyama (-9), J.J. Spaun (-8), and Gary Woodland and Keegan Bradley, both of whom are six under par.

A win on Sunday would be the first of Smith’s PGA Tour career. The 33-year-old Englishman has one other top 10 on his resume this season — a solo third-place finish at the Valspar Championship in March.

Smith will play in Saturday afternoon’s final grouping alongside Michael Thorbjornsen and Ryan Gerard at 1:15 p.m. ET.

Heading into the final round of the Augusta National Women’s Amateur, 17-year-old Asterisk Talley has some unfinished business to accomplish.

One year ago, the star American amateur came up one shot short of the ANWA title, despite shooting a final-round 68 at the home of the Masters. This year is a different story.

Talley cruised through 36 holes at Champions Retreat on Wednesday and Thursday, making zero bogeys and finishing with a one-shot lead.

Her 11-under total through two rounds matches her total score at last year’s ANWA. Now, the final round at Augusta National is the only thing that stands between her and history. Meja Örtengren and Maria Jose Marin are tied for second at 10 under.

The third round of the 2026 Farmers Insurance Open kicks off Saturday, January 31, at Torrey Pines in California. You can find full Farmers Insurance Open tee times for Saturday’s third round at the bottom of this post.

Brooks Koepka’s PGA Tour return stole the headlines this week, and in his first start since leaving LIV Golf, Koepka will be around for the weekend, firing rounds of 73-68 to make the cut on the number at three under par.

If he wants to get back into the mix and contend, though, he has a lot of work to do in the next two rounds. Koepka currently trails the tournament leader, Justin Rose, by a whopping 14 shots.

Rose holds a four-shot lead over Irishman Seamus Power heading into the weekend after Rose fired rounds of 62-65 to reach 17 under.

A win this week would mark the 13th of Rose’s PGA Tour career — and his second Farmers Insurance title, after winning the tournament in 2019.

Rose will get his third round started on Saturday afternoon in the final grouping alongside Power and Joel Dahmen (-11) at 1:07 p.m. ET.
